在Web开发中,理解如何使用GET方法提交表单对于构建动态网页至关重要。GET方法通常用于向服务器请求数据,而不涉及数据的修改。本文将深入探讨使用GET方法提交表单的实用技巧,并通过实例解析帮助读者轻松掌握这一技能。
什么是GET方法?
GET方法是一种HTTP方法,用于从服务器请求资源。当使用GET方法提交表单时,表单数据被附加到URL中,这意味着所有提交的数据都会在URL中可见。这种方法适用于请求非敏感数据,例如搜索查询或获取信息。
实用技巧
1. 简化URL
使用GET方法时,确保URL简洁明了。避免在URL中使用复杂的数据结构,因为过长的URL可能会引起问题,如浏览器缓存限制。
2. 使用参数名
为表单字段使用描述性参数名,以便于阅读和调试。例如,使用username而不是u。
3. 避免敏感数据
GET方法不适用于包含敏感数据的表单,如密码。敏感数据应使用POST方法提交。
4. 限制数据大小
GET方法通常受限于URL长度,因此避免提交大量数据。
5. 测试URL编码
确保所有提交的数据都经过URL编码,以防止特殊字符导致问题。
实例解析
以下是一个简单的HTML表单示例,演示如何使用GET方法提交数据:
<!DOCTYPE html>
<html lang="en">
<head>
<meta charset="UTF-8">
<title>GET 表单示例</title>
</head>
<body>
<form action="/submit-form" method="GET">
<label for="username">用户名:</label>
<input type="text" id="username" name="username">
<label for="age">年龄:</label>
<input type="number" id="age" name="age">
<input type="submit" value="提交">
</form>
</body>
</html>
在这个例子中,当用户填写表单并提交时,数据将以以下URL的形式发送到服务器:
/submit-form?username=JohnDoe&age=30
服务器可以解析这个URL,提取参数值,并根据这些值执行相应的操作。
总结
通过掌握这些实用技巧和实例解析,你可以轻松地在Web开发中使用GET方法提交表单。记住,GET方法适用于请求非敏感数据,并且要注意URL的长度和数据的安全性。在实际开发中,灵活运用这些技巧将有助于创建高效且易于维护的Web应用程序。
